A theoretical model for the refractive index μ\muμ of a specialized optical glass depends on the incident light wavelength λ\lambdaλ according to the relation μ(λ)=(1625+25λ)−32\mu(\lambda) = \left( \frac{16}{25} + \frac{2}{5}\lambda \right)^{-\frac{3}{2}}μ(λ)=(2516​+52​λ)−23​

Determine the range of values of λ\lambdaλ for which the binomial expansion of μ(λ)\mu(\lambda)μ(λ) in ascending powers of λ\lambdaλ is valid.
